引言PHP作为一种广泛应用于Web开发的脚本语言,面试中对PHP的考察也是非常常见的。面对面试中的难题,如何巧妙应对,成为许多PHP开发者关心的问题。本文将结合实战经验和解析,为您提供一套应对PHP面...
PHP作为一种广泛应用于Web开发的脚本语言,面试中对PHP的考察也是非常常见的。面对面试中的难题,如何巧妙应对,成为许多PHP开发者关心的问题。本文将结合实战经验和解析,为您提供一套应对PHP面试难题的策略,助你轻松应对面试挑战。
常见问题:请介绍一下PHP的发展历程。
解析:PHP起源于1994年,由Rasmus Lerdorf创建。最初,PHP主要用于网页表单处理,后来逐渐发展成为一个功能强大的服务器端脚本语言。PHP的发展历程可以概括为以下几个阶段:
应对策略:在面试中,你可以简要介绍PHP的发展历程,并重点介绍PHP 5.x及以后的版本,突出其新特性和改进。
常见问题:请解释一下MySQL中的存储过程。
解析:存储过程是一组为了完成特定功能的SQL语句集合,它被编译并存储在数据库中。使用存储过程可以提高数据库的执行效率,并简化复杂的业务逻辑。
应对策略:在面试中,你可以解释存储过程的概念、特点和应用场景,并举例说明如何使用MySQL中的存储过程。
常见问题:请介绍一下Laravel框架。
解析:Laravel是一个流行的PHP框架,它提供了丰富的内置功能和组件,如路由、中间件、数据库迁移、分页等,可以帮助开发者快速构建高质量的Web应用。
应对策略:在面试中,你可以介绍Laravel框架的基本概念、特点、常用组件和应用场景,并举例说明如何使用Laravel框架进行开发。
常见问题:请谈谈你遵循的编码规范。
解析:遵循编码规范可以提高代码的可读性、可维护性和可复用性。常见的编码规范包括:
应对策略:在面试中,你可以介绍你遵循的编码规范,并举例说明如何在实际项目中应用这些规范。
PHP面试中常见的难题涉及基础知识、数据库、框架、工具和编码规范等方面。通过掌握相关知识和实战经验,你可以巧妙应对面试难题,提升自己的面试能力。祝你面试顺利!